Dr. Ibrahim Bangura, the leading aspirant for the All People’s Congress (APC) Flagbearer position, has delivered a strong, confidence-boosting message to the APC family and the nation, assuring them that the integrity of Sierra Leone’s 2028 elections will be fully safeguarded under his leadership.

Speaking to thousands of supporters, members, and well-wishers at the Bassa Town field in Waterloo, on Saturday 15th November 2025. Dr. Bangura emphasized that his vast experience in public administration, has prepared him to confront and prevent electoral malpractice at every level.

 

He firmly stated that once entrusted with the APC Flagbearership and eventually elected as the party’s presidential candidate, he will ensure that no process is allowed to undermine the will of the people. Sierra Leoneaens deserves elections rooted in transparency, fairness, and accountability.” He said.

 

Dr. Bangura noted that his maturity, leadership strength, and years of service have equipped him with the strategic insight needed to design and enforce systems capable of upholding electoral integrity. “The 2028 elections must reflect the genuine voice of Sierra Leoneans,” he declared, assuring supporters that every stage of the electoral process will be monitored diligently and professionally.

 

In a direct message to the ruling Sierra Leone People’s Party (SLPP), Dr. Bangura cautioned that the upcoming elections will not be “business as usual.” Instead, he said, it will be a defining moment when the true mandate of the people shines through a mandate that the APC, under his guidance, is fully prepared to defend.

 

He called on APC delegates across the country to entrust him with their confidence as the party moves toward its convention. Dr. Bangura reaffirmed his readiness to lead the APC to victory and to steer Sierra Leone toward a future characterized by Heal, Unite and Build a renewed national purpose.
